Katima Gram Panchayat, Kusmi

Katima is a Gram Panchayat located in the Balrampur-Ramanujganj district of Chhattisgarh. It falls under the Kusmi Janpad Panchayat and Balrampur-Ramanujganj Zila Panchayat. Katima Gram Panchayat covers a total of 2 villages: Katima and Pakari Toli.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Katima Gram Panchayat

Katima Gram Panchayat is part of Chhattisgarh's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Katima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Kusmi Janpad Panchayat is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Katima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Balrampur-Ramanujganj Zila Panchayat is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Katima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
